Cadillac F1 denies sale rumors amid FBI investigation into owner
Yahoo Sports • 1 min read • Latest: Aug 21, 2026, 9:17 PM
Last updated Aug 21, 2026

Cadillac F1 has refuted speculation regarding a possible sale of the team amid an ongoing FBI investigation into owner Mark Walter's financial dealings. As Formula 1 action resumes in Zandvoort this weekend, TWG Global, Cadillac’s joint venture partner, stated it is not considering divesting any motorsport assets. Federal authorities are examining Walter's broader financial network, particularly concerning related-party private-credit transactions involving subsidiary companies. The inquiry has led to questions about stability for Walter's investments, including his partial stakes in major sports franchises. Further developments could impact not just Cadillac F1 but also other teams under Walter's TWG Global portfolio.
